Playstation.Blog: From Sketch to Screen: Secret Agent Clank

Playstation.Blog writes: "The great thing about the Ratchet & Clank universe being such a diverse and creative place is that you can take something like a robot-spy-themed game and it fits perfectly in. Our Designers do such a great job of helping the Environment Artists visualize the world that on Secret Agent Clank we started with a brainstorming meeting between the two departments.

This consisted of the Designers saying something like "We would love to see Clank stealthily going through a Rio de Janeiro-esque carnival level," and as the creative types we are as Artists we would say "that's neat but how about a Space Circus?" After their laughter died down we would bounce ideas around until we all settle on a common vision such as a bird-people carnival level. " (PSP, Secret Agent Clank)
